How enterprise IT teams use our softphone

01CLINICALHealthcare Enterprise, CUCM/PBX-Dependent Clinical Staff

Replaced Jabber on a clinical fleet before the deprecation date

Replace Jabber on your clinical fleet without touching CUCM. Cloud Softphone ships via MDM as a managed config push — staff re-authenticate once, policy-managed devices stay locked down, local push delivers calls to the lock screen. Keep the PBX, swap the client layer, meet your deprecation deadline.

  • MDM-pushed config with single re-auth for clinical staff
  • Local push to policy-managed, locked-down devices
  • CUCM-compatible, zero PBX changes required

PBX untouchedClient layer swapped, deprecation deadline met

02LOGISTICSLarge-Fleet Logistics Enterprise, Avaya Migration

Replaced Avaya Workplace across a multi-thousand-device fleet

Replace Avaya Workplace across your device fleet without touching a single handset manually. Android Zero-Touch and Apple DEP enroll, configure, and register every device with no end-user steps and no SIP credentials surfaced to staff. White-labeled build ships under your brand from day one.

  • Android Zero-Touch and Apple DEP enrollment at fleet scale
  • SIP credentials never in end-user hands
  • Branded build deployed centrally, no per-device configuration

0 end-user stepsDevices enroll, configure, and register on their own

03MULTISITEMulti-Site & Multinational Enterprise, Fragmented Regional PBX

One app, one brand, one workflow across regions

Standardize on one white-labeled client across every region without replacing the PBX underneath. SRTP and ZRTP layer onto your existing infrastructure, provisioning centralizes to one portal, and every site runs the same app and the same support workflow. IT operates one surface regardless of regional switch variance.

  • SRTP and ZRTP over existing PBX, no infrastructure replacement
  • Centralized provisioning across all regions from one portal
  • Single white-labeled app and support workflow across all sites

1 app · 1 portalAny PBX underneath, every region standardized
